
Pakistan has a diverse market for fragrances, with a wide range of local and international perfume brands available. Here are some of the most popular perfumes in Pakistan:
-
J. by Junaid Jamshed: This is a popular Pakistani fragrance brand that offers a range of scents for both men and women. Their fragrances are made with high-quality ingredients and are known for their long-lasting effect.
-
Chanel No. 5: This is a classic perfume that has been popular in Pakistan for many years. It has a floral scent that is both feminine and timeless.
-
Hugo Boss: This brand offers a range of fragrances for men and women, which are known for their unique and long-lasting scents.
-
Davidoff Cool Water: This is a popular fragrance for men that has a fresh and aquatic scent. It’s perfect for everyday wear and is one of the most popular fragrances in Pakistan.
-
Gucci Bloom: This is a popular women’s fragrance that has a floral scent with a touch of musk. It’s known for its long-lasting effect and is a favorite among women in Pakistan.
-
Versace Eros: This is a popular men’s fragrance that has a woody and spicy scent. It’s perfect for special occasions and is known for its long-lasting effect.
-
Tom Ford Noir: This is a luxurious men’s fragrance that has a sensual and warm scent. It’s perfect for evening wear and is popular among men in Pakistan.
-
Yves Saint Laurent Black Opium: This is a popular women’s fragrance that has a sweet and spicy scent. It’s perfect for evening wear and is one of the most popular fragrances in Pakistan.
-
Dolce & Gabbana Light Blue: This is a popular women’s fragrance that has a fresh and fruity scent. It’s perfect for everyday wear and is a favorite among women in Pakistan.
-
Calvin Klein Eternity: This is a classic fragrance that has been popular in Pakistan for many years. It has a floral scent that is both feminine and sophisticated.
These are just a few examples of the most popular perfumes in Pakistan. The choice of fragrance depends on personal preferences, occasions, and budgets. It’s recommended to test a fragrance before buying to ensure that it’s a good fit and matches the individual’s personality and style.
